在Windows 11操作系统中,防火墙作为核心安全防护机制,其关闭操作涉及系统设置、服务管理、策略配置等多维度调整。完全关闭防火墙需综合考虑基础功能禁用、关联服务终止、规则清理及系统策略覆盖等环节。此操作虽可满足特定场景(如本地网络调试、软件兼容性测试)需求,但会显著降低系统抵御网络攻击的能力,且可能触发安全软件警报。本文将从技术实现路径、系统影响范围、操作风险等级等角度,系统阐述八种关闭方案及其差异化特征。

w	in11怎么完全关闭防火墙

一、基础设置层关闭

通过系统防火墙设置界面直接关闭,属于最表层的操作方式。

  • 操作路径:进入控制面板→系统和安全→Windows Defender防火墙,点击“关闭Windows Defender防火墙”选项
  • 影响范围:仅关闭图形化界面的防火墙主开关,未触及底层服务
  • 局限性:重启后可能自动恢复启用状态

二、服务管理层终止

通过禁用防火墙相关服务实现深度关闭,需管理员权限。

服务名称 依赖关系 操作风险
MpSvc Windows Defender核心服务 禁用后实时防护失效
DcomLaunch 分布式COM组件基础服务 影响RPC通信功能
BaseFilterEngine 过滤引擎核心组件 导致网络监控功能异常

三、组策略强制覆盖

通过修改本地组策略实现系统性关闭,适用于企业级环境。

  1. 打开gpedit.msc进入组策略编辑器
  2. 定位至计算机配置→管理模板→网络→网络连接
  3. 启用“禁止Internet连接共享”并设置为已启用
  4. Windows Defender Firewall节点下关闭所有策略项

四、注册表键值修改

直接操作注册表实现底层配置变更,需谨慎操作。

注册表路径 键值名称 修改效果
HKEY_LOCAL_MACHINESYSTEMCurrentControlSetServicesSharedAccess Start 4(禁用)→ 0(启动)双向切换
HKEY_LOCAL_MACHINESOFTWAREPoliciesMicrosoftWindowsFirewall EnableFirewall 0(关闭)→ 1(开启)数值调整
HKEY_LOCAL_MACHINESYSTEMCurrentControlSetServicesBFE StartupType 修改为0x00000004可彻底禁用

五、命令行批量处理

通过PowerShell脚本实现自动化关闭,适合批量部署场景。

# 停止防火墙服务
Stop-Service -Name MpSvc -Force
Stop-Service -Name SharedAccess -Force

禁用服务启动类型

Set-Service -Name MpSvc -StartupType Disabled Set-Service -Name SharedAccess -StartupType Disabled

清除防火墙规则

Get-NetFirewallRule | Remove-NetFirewallRule -Confirm:$false

六、第三方工具干预

使用专业工具绕过系统限制,存在兼容性风险。

工具名称 工作原理 风险等级
Firewall Control 临时禁用防火墙监控进程 低(可恢复)
WinTools NetPro 直接修改系统网络配置 中(可能破坏网络栈)
Process Explorer 强制结束防火墙进程 高(系统不稳定)

七、网络适配器绑定解除

通过修改网络适配器属性取消防火墙绑定。

  1. 进入网络和Internet设置→高级网络设置
  2. 选择目标网络适配器→点击“属性”
  3. 取消勾选“Windows Defender防火墙”复选框
  4. 确认绑定解除后重启网络适配器

八、系统还原点保护

创建系统还原点防范关闭操作引发的故障。

操作阶段 保护措施 恢复方式
关闭前 创建系统还原点 通过控制面板回滚
服务修改后 导出服务配置 导入备份文件恢复
注册表修改后 导出相关键值 双击.reg文件还原

在完成防火墙的全面关闭后,系统将处于无网络防护状态,此时需特别注意:避免连接不可信网络、禁用远程桌面功能、及时备份重要数据。对于软件开发者而言,建议在虚拟机环境中进行测试,防止真实系统暴露于风险中。企业级用户应优先考虑域策略集中管理,而非单独关闭客户端防火墙。若需恢复防火墙功能,可通过系统服务重启、组策略重置或系统还原点回滚实现,建议定期验证防护状态确保系统安全。